This artwork is a modern interpretation of Gond Art, blending traditional patterns with contemporary fashion elements. Gond Art, a tribal art form from India, is known for its intricate line work, repetitive patterns, and vibrant storytelling.

In this piece, the background consists of herringbone-style patterns, resembling the fine detailing often found in Gond paintings. The foreground features stylized illustrations of fashion accessories such as a watch, glasses, handbag, wallet, and high-heeled boot, all outlined in a bold, hand-drawn style. The limited earthy color palette, dominated by warm orange and black, aligns with traditional Gond aesthetics while maintaining a modern, minimalist appeal.

This unique fusion of tribal patterns with fashion elements highlights the adaptability of Gond Art, transforming it into a contemporary, stylish composition suitable for editorial illustrations, textile design, or branding concepts.

This image is a digital greeting card for the festival of Holi, a popular Indian festival celebrating colors, joy, and the arrival of spring. The design features a flute (associated with Lord Krishna), a peacock feather (a symbol often linked to Krishna and beauty), and vibrant splashes of color representing the playful spirit of Holi.
